Welcome to an island with some of the most varied and spectacular scenery in the Mediterranean. For many, Majorca will need no real introduction, yet even for those who have visited the island many times, it still has an amazing capacity to surprise and delight. Of course, the beaches are still wonderful, the sun still shines and there is a wealth of mouth-watering local and international cuisine on offer which can be as simple or sophisticated as your fancy and wallet takes you. A little exploration and imagination can reveal the most amazing sights and experiences tiny coves, soaring mountains, deserted bays, picturesque villages, colourful markets, hidden forests, panoramic vistas, smart marinas, ancient monasteries and secluded beaches reached only by snaking, mountain roads. Apart from the coast, which varies enormously around the island, there is a whole host of inland trasures, some of which can be glimpsed from the picturesque railway which winds its way through orange groves from Soller to Palma, the vibrant, cosmopolitan capital with its magnificent cathedral. Most of the island can be reached within an hour's drive so a whole day can really allow you to explore at a leisurely pace.
